Syria Disperses Weapons Supply

In an attempt to detract a possible U.S. bombing campaign, and circumvent surrendering its supply of chemical weapons as Russia has advocated, a covert Syrian military unit has allegedly been dispersing hoards of munitions and poison gas in about 50 sites across the country.
U.S. and Israeli intelligence representatives are still convinced that they have knowledge as to where most of Syrian President Bashar al Assad’s chemical weapons are being held – but not as much as they were earlier this year. U.S. Secretary of State John Kerry was present in Geneva Thursday for political dialog with Russia on halting the Syrian weapons program, according to Businessweek.
